L.A. Dance Project is a platform for the development, creation, support, and presentation of world-class dance in Los Angeles. Comprised of an internationally acclaimed dance company, a performance space in LA’s Arts District, and a program of media initiatives, LADP seeks to foster dance-centered artistic collaborations across all disciplines, cultures, and communities in Los Angeles and around the globe.
Since its founding, L.A. Dance Project’s company has toured and given master classes at international venues and festivals, including the Holland Festival, the Edinburgh International Festival, La Maison de la Danse, the Saitama Arts Center, Sadler’s Wells Theatre, Shanghai and Beijing Opera Houses, and the Théâtre du Châtelet. In the U.S., the company has performed at venues including Jacob’s Pillow, Brooklyn Academy of Music, and New York City Center. In its home city of Los Angeles, the company has performed at Walt Disney Concert Hall, MOCA, Union Station, the Theatre at Ace Hotel, and the Wallis Annenberg Center for the Performing Arts.
